Invited-Speaker Sessions feature some of the most prestigious experts in their fields and highlight a wide range of topics that appeal to a broad base of attendees. Examples include:

  • Clinical Symposium 
  • Live Demonstrations 
  • State-of-the-Art Lecture 

 

Abstract-Based Sessions feature the latest research findings in the field of gastroenterology. Accepted abstracts may be presented in lecture or poster sessions. Examples include: 

  • Poster Sessions 
  • Late-Breaking Abstract Plenary 
  • Video Plenary

Industry Sessions are hosted by our trusted industry partners. Examples include:  

  • Product Theater 
  • Satellite Symposium 

 

Networking Sessions & Special Events include sessions and receptions outside the traditional DDW session types. Examples include: 

  • Meet-the-Expert Sessions 
  • Reception/Special Event
